Senate Select Committee on Health Care Consumer Access and Affordability

Active dates:2017-2018
Function:

This Select Committee will explore new ideas to improve health care in Minnesota. The committee doesn’t have authority to consider and adopt legislation, but will present ideas to the Health and Human Services budget committee in 2018.

History:

The Select Committee met for the first time on July 12, 2017. Senator Scott Jensen was chosen to chair the committee, which was tasked with developing ideas to make Minnesota health care more affordable, and to present its ideas and findings to the Health and Human Services budget committee in 2018. The committee met six additional times between August and October 2017, and twice in January 2018. It's last meeting was held on March 8, 2018. 

Membership: Scott Jensen (Chair); Julie Rosen; Melissa Wiklund; Rich Draheim; Nick Frentz; Mary Kiffmeyer; Matt Klein; Eric Pratt; Daniel Sparks
